Caramel Covered Cheetos.....
2 cups light brown sugar
1 cup margarine or butter
1/2 cup light corn syrup
1/2 tsp baking soda
1 18- 20.5 oz. pkg. Cheetos® - crunchy( not cheese puffs)
Preheat oven to 250.
In a large pan, mix sugar, margarine or butter and corn syrup. Bring to a boil. Boil 5 minutes, stirring often. Remove from heat and add soda. Stir until light in color and foamy.
Pour Cheetos in a large bowl. Pour caramel mixture over the Cheetos and stir, coating each piece. Transfer to a large roasting/jelly roll pan (15x10). Bake for 1 hour, stirring every 15 minutes.
Remove from oven and spread out into a single layer on some non-stick aluminum foil. Break into pieces once it has stared to cool.
